Young Jeezy, born Jeffrey Wayne Carter, is an American rapper, record producer, and actor. Born on September 28, 1977, he is known for his unique musical style and street culture background. Jeezy has had a significant impact in the music industry, with his work spanning multiple genres including hip-hop, R&B, and Southern hip-hop. more
